Settling Foundation Service in Colonia, NJ
Settling foundation services address issues related to uneven or shifting foundations in residential properties. These services typically involve stabilizing and leveling the foundation to prevent further movement and protect the structural integrity of the building. Projects may include mudjacking, pier and beam adjustments, or underpinning to correct uneven floors, cracked walls, or sticking doors and windows. Homeowners usually seek this service when noticing signs of foundation movement or experiencing structural concerns that could compromise safety and property value.

Settling Foundation Service Questions
What are signs of foundation settling? Common signs include u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ation or exterior walls.
Why does a foundation settle? Settlement can occur due to soil shrinkage, erosion, or changes in moisture levels around the property.
What types of projects involve settling foundation services? Projects often include leveling uneven slabs, repairing cracked walls, or stabilizing sinking foundations.
How can settling issues affect a property? Settling can lead to structural damage, reduced stability, and potential safety concerns if not addressed promptly.
